Tour de France 2017 – Stage 19 [LAST 10 KM]

34059
Mirrors:

Description

July 21, 2017

Tour de France 2017 – Stage 19 – Embrun – Salon de Provence : 222,5 km

The 2017 Tour de France will be the 104th edition of the Tour de France,


Show more...




Published on July 21, 2017 by Tiz Category Tag
0 0 votes
Article Rating
Subscribe
Notify of
guest

0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ments